Transaction 084158ade8726d533d905456c74e37971bccd5924b7d15add2a25fb0a01e695b

1 Input
2 Outputs
  • 084158ade8726d533d905456c74e37971bccd5924b7d15add2a25fb0a01e695b:0
  • value  167388
    address  36tc2PscVEY5pePcfyTP8zGRR7fZRtx2MM
  • 084158ade8726d533d905456c74e37971bccd5924b7d15add2a25fb0a01e695b:1
  • value  124461170
    address  1CtXV4HnEbsZ2AndbsEaQ77vAR1UX7rEuY